About

Ice Cave Trail is a 6.8-mile out-and-back hike located in Arizona near Arizona. The trail features 515 feet of elevation gain, making it a moderately accessible option for hikers of various skill levels. The out-and-back format allows hikers to turn back at any point, offering flexibility in how much distance they want to cover. The trail is managed by trackswhitemountains.org, which maintains information about conditions and access. This resource can provide updates on trail status, seasonal considerations, and any relevant guidelines for visitors. The relatively modest elevation gain spread across the full distance means a steady but not steep grade for most of the hike. At 6.8 miles total, hikers should plan for a few hours to complete the round trip, depending on pace and breaks taken.
